Established in 1926, Family Service League is a social services agency transforming lives and communities through mental health, addiction, housing, and essential human services with more than 60 social service programs in over 20 locations.SCHEDULEMonday – Friday, 9:00AM – 5:00PMSome evening availability requiredSummaryFamily Service League is seeking a full-time Program Directorfor the OnTrack program in Mastic. The Program Director will provide clinical and administrative oversite to an interdisciplinary team which will provide clinical services to adolescents and adults who are newly experiencing the onset of psychosis and who may also be experiencing other behavioral health disorders. This position has a hybrid schedule of onsite (clinic-based) and field work, as well as in person and telehealth services. The Program Director will receive expert training and technical assistance in a structured, empirically supported model of assessment and treatment (OnTrack NY, through the Center for Practice Innovations at Columbia Psychiatry and New York State Research Foundation for Mental Hygiene).We Offer a Generous Benefits Package Including The Following

Responsibilities
  • The Program Director will oversee staff, including recruiting, hiring, training, developing, and conducting supervision and performance appraisals.
  • Provide clinical and administrative oversight to the interdisciplinary team that includes Master's level clinicians, certified peers, registered nurses, and psychiatric nurse practitioners.
  • The Program Director will facilitate the provision of screening, assessment and ongoing clinical interventions using a solution focused and multicultural perspective to adolescents and adults with psychosis and the full range of DSM diagnoses.
  • Facilitate eligibility screening for young people referred to the OnTrack NY program and facilitate referral and linkage to people who are ineligible for services or more appropriate for other levels of care.
  • Ensure 24/7 on call coverage for individuals served.
  • The Program Director will ensure completion of all clinical documentation in accordance with NYS Office of Mental Health in an electronic medical record, including progress notes, intake assessments, care coordination, discharge planning, and treatment plans.
  • Coordinate and connect to participants' families and community resources.
  • Lead routine supervision/team meetings.
  • Understand and demonstrate a commitment to Performance Quality Insurance (PQI) and accreditation with the Council on Accreditation for Children and Family Services (COA).
  • Provide additional support/services to the clinic proper, as needed.
  • Complete trainings and maintain proficiency with de-escalation skills.
  • All other duties as assigned.
QualificationsMaster's degree in a related behavioral health field required.LCSW, LMHC, LMFT or related licensed clinical degree required. LCSW preferred.At least 5 years of clinical experience in a behavioral health setting required. Clinic experience preferred.At Least 3 Years Of Supervisory Experience Required.Excellent interpersonal skills and strong verbal and written communication skills required.Ability to problem solve, make clear decisions and work as part of a teamProficient computer skills, including Microsoft Office and Electronic Health Records required.Bilingual Spanish strongly preferred.Some evening and weekend hours may be required.Valid and clean NYS Driver's License required.Physical RequirementsAbility to sit and stand for long periods of time.
